CISA Flags Actively Exploited n8n RCE Bug as 24,700 Instances Remain Exposed

via The Hacker Newsinfo@thehackernews.com (The Hacker News)2w ago

The U.S.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) on Wednesday added a critical security flaw impacting n8n to its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, based on evidence of active exploitation.
